Humanity Protocol achieves human uniqueness verification through palm print recognition technology combined with zkEVM Layer 2 blockchain and zero-knowledge proofs. PoH, as a new consensus, prevents bots and fake accounts, ensuring that users are real and unique.
The system generates Self-Sovereign Identity (SSI), which users can use for KYC, DAO voting, and airdrops, and is jointly maintained by zkProofer and verification nodes to ensure a fair and transparent verification process.
$H total supply is 10 billion, with allocations covering ecological construction, node rewards, community incentives, and team and investor protection agreement development. The token functions include identification verification fees, governance participation, and reward distribution.
PoH not only promotes fair voting and prevents airdrop abuse, but also integrates DePIN hardware to create seamless identification, becoming a multi-chain passport that extends to L3 and cross-chain applications, advancing new standards for Web3 identification.
